博客 Ranger框架下实现字段隐藏的技术方法

Ranger框架下实现字段隐藏的技术方法

   数栈君   发表于 1 天前  2  0

如何在Ranger框架下实现字段隐藏的技术方法

1. 引言

在现代数据管理中,字段隐藏是一种重要的数据安全技术,用于在特定条件下隐藏敏感数据字段,以保护用户隐私和数据安全。Ranger框架作为一种强大的数据治理和访问控制平台,提供了丰富的功能来实现字段隐藏。本文将详细探讨如何在Ranger框架下实现字段隐藏,并解释其技术原理和应用场景。

2. Ranger框架概述

Apache Ranger 是一个开源的数据安全和治理框架,旨在提供企业级的数据保护能力。它支持多种数据源,包括Hadoop HDFS、Hive、HBase等,并提供了基于角色的访问控制(RBAC)和字段级访问控制功能。Ranger的核心目标是帮助企业在大数据环境中实现细粒度的数据访问控制。

3. 字段隐藏的技术背景

字段隐藏是指在数据展示或查询过程中,根据用户的权限或特定的业务规则,动态隐藏敏感字段。这种技术在数据中台、数字孪生和数字可视化等领域尤为重要,因为它能够有效保护敏感信息,同时不影响其他用户的正常数据访问。

4. Ranger框架下的字段隐藏实现原理

在Ranger框架中,字段隐藏主要通过以下机制实现:

  • 数据访问控制: Ranger通过定义数据策略,限制用户对特定字段的访问权限。
  • 动态字段过滤: 在数据查询过程中,Ranger可以根据用户的角色或权限,动态过滤敏感字段。
  • 基于角色的访问控制(RBAC): Ranger支持基于角色的访问控制,确保只有授权用户才能访问特定字段。

5. 在Ranger中实现字段隐藏的具体步骤

要在Ranger框架中实现字段隐藏,可以按照以下步骤进行:

  1. 配置数据策略: 在Ranger中定义数据策略,指定需要隐藏的字段和相关规则。
  2. 设置访问控制: 为不同用户或角色分配访问权限,确保只有授权用户才能查看敏感字段。
  3. 动态过滤规则: 在数据查询时,Ranger会根据预定义的规则,动态过滤敏感字段。
  4. 测试和验证: 在生产环境中部署前,进行全面的测试,确保字段隐藏功能正常工作。

6. 字段隐藏在数据中台中的应用

在数据中台场景中,字段隐藏技术可以帮助企业实现数据的分级分类管理。例如,在数据可视化平台中,普通用户只能看到非敏感字段,而高级管理员则可以查看所有字段。这种分级访问控制机制能够有效保护敏感数据,同时满足不同角色的业务需求。

7. Ranger框架下字段隐藏的优势

使用Ranger框架实现字段隐藏具有以下优势:

  • 灵活性: Ranger支持多种数据源和访问控制规则,能够满足不同场景的需求。
  • 可扩展性: Ranger的插件架构允许用户根据需要扩展功能。
  • 高性能: Ranger优化了数据访问控制的性能,确保在大数据环境中的高效运行。

8. 挑战与解决方案

在Ranger框架下实现字段隐藏也面临一些挑战:

  • 性能影响: 动态字段过滤可能对查询性能产生一定影响,需要通过优化查询和索引设计来缓解。
  • 配置复杂性: 定义复杂的访问控制规则可能需要较高的配置和维护成本。

为了解决这些问题,可以考虑使用自动化工具或平台来简化配置和管理。例如,申请试用我们的解决方案,可以帮助您更高效地配置和管理Ranger框架下的字段隐藏功能。

9. 结论

字段隐藏是保护敏感数据的重要技术,而Ranger框架提供了强大的功能来实现这一目标。通过合理配置数据策略和访问控制规则,企业可以在数据中台、数字孪生和数字可视化等领域有效保护数据安全。如果您对Ranger框架感兴趣,可以访问我们的网站了解更多详情:https://www.dtstack.com/?src=bbs

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料
钉钉扫码加入技术交流群